ORIENTEERING The chilly moorland of Yoxter Ranges, high on the Mendip Hills, provided the plenty of challenges to young minds and legs in the December round of the Avon Schools Orienteering League.
At the halfway point of the team competition Kingswood School continue to head league champions Bristol Grammar. However, the lead has been cut to 47 points after the latter claimed four class winners in their total of 568 from a maximum of 600.See the full content of this document
